@Configuration
时间: 2023-10-27 22:48:47 浏览: 27
@Configuration 是什么意思?
@Configuration 是 Spring 框架中的一个注解,用于标记一个 Java 类是一个配置类。配置类用于定义 Spring 应用上下文中的 beans,并且可以使用 @Bean 注解声明一个 bean 实例。@Configuration 注解的类在运行时被 Spring 容器解析,并且由容器中的其他 bean 所引用。该注解与其他 Spring 注解一起使用,可以为应用程序提供依赖注入和面向切面的编程等特性。
相关问题
@configuration
`@configuration` 是 Spring 框架中的一个注解,表示这个类是一个配置类,用于定义一些 Bean 的创建和配置信息。在 Spring Boot 应用中,一般会使用 `@SpringBootApplication` 注解来标识主配置类,它本身就是一个配置类,相当于同时加上了 `@Configuration`、`@EnableAutoConfiguration` 和 `@ComponentScan` 三个注解。通过使用 `@configuration` 注解,我们可以将相关的 Bean 配置信息集中在一个类中进行管理,方便维护和管理。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)